    Charcoal is located at The Wynwood Yard and offers charcoal-fired foods and other American finds. AMBIANCE: Industrial looking and made up of modified shipping containers. There's ample seating space outside and limited inside space. I would encourage to make a reservation and specify where you want to sit. They use Resy. Moreover, the early seating times for Sunday brunch attract crying babies to add to the background music. FOOD: Brunch selections and sandwiches are $16. Wood fired meats are in the $25 price range. During my visit, I wanted brunch items so this is what I tried: Belgium Waffles: 5/5 - yeasted waffles that almost taste like pastry on English vanilla creme. This is a great choice. French Toast: 3/5 - It's almost like monkey bread bathed in custard. The Swede: 1/5 - This is a miss for me. the star of the plate didn't shine, in fact it was flavorless. Small and pitiful compared to other items. SERVICE: Where to begin? It was our main server's first day and she could not recommend any dishes. The person who was cleaning up the table dropped a drink on me. Aside from this, I thought they were attentive and our waters were never empty. Overall, I enjoyed the company and think Charcoal has potential. I love the ambiance and maybe I should have gone for charcoal-fire foods. At the same time, if they offer other items, they should be on par with charcoal-fire foods and I feel they were not.

    Not sure why it got 4 stars. I came to this place after my friend heard from her classmates about this new restaurant and we decided to check it out. Below is my impression: FOOD We order the charcuterie plate, scallops, breadcrumbs and the pork. I guess it was our error to not ask what it comes with. We should have ordered some side dishes to go with our main course. The pork was a little dry and the breadcrumbs that came highly recommended by the waiter was normal and tasteless. However, the scallops were great and I really enjoyed. SERVICE The waiter was nice but she barely stopped at our table to check if we needed anything else. We asked for suggestion and the only suggestive she gave us was the breadcrumbs. definitely an opportunity for the staff to be familiar with the menu and suggest first timers on what to order. DECOR/ AMBIANCE The restaurant is inside Wynwood yard. It is outdoors so if you can't stand the heat, do not visit during summer. The music at the background and the clean and simple decoration were great. OVERALL Two Stars. One for the decor and one for the ambiance. Taken a star away from food, one from service. The 5th star is the wow factor, there wasn't.
